Is this on two tracks or you trying to have split times on one track?

If two tracks you can run a T spliter right out of the back of the box and hook up two loops to it. We have three going to our box at Nor-cal hobbies in Union City 1 on Each of the offroads tracks and one on the asphalt track. Works great as long as you don't have people running on the other tracks while racing going on one.
